Lucozade Sport has extended its partnership with London Marathon Events, agreeing a new deal which will run from 2021 to 2023.
The partnership means Lucozade Sport will continue to be the official sports drink and gels provider for the London Marathon and The Vitality Big Half.
The move also takes the brand’s sponsorship of the London Marathon to the 21 year mark – making it the longest serving incumbent partner.
The brand says that plans for this year’s Virgin Money London Marathon will see every Lucozade Sport bottle distributed on course made from recycled plastic, with a closed loop system put in place to collect the bottles and return them to Lucozade Sport, with the aim of recycling every bottle again afterwards.
To celebrate the partnership, Lucozade Sport has also created a virtual 10km race event that will take place on 12th September and will encourage people to complete their run in their local area at their own pace.
The new event will see an ‘optional fee’ of £5 donated to the charity Women in Sport.
